On Sep 17, 2007, at 12:40 PM, Matthias Leisi wrote:
Google was not helpful on this subject, so you may be able to help to
reveal the status of DNSxL notation for IPv6.

What would make sense, and what not? What has already been tried?

We need better protocols.  DNS was never designed for this.

I believe a number of next-generation protocols have been developed, or are being developed.

At my company we use a very simple protocol; it runs on UDP with retry and failover to TCP, just like DNS. The serialization codec is based on BitTorrent so it already has library support in many languages.
